UP 2026 Admissions – Important Dates and How to Apply

University Of Pretoria has officially opened applications for the 2026 academic year. Both undergraduate and postgraduate applicants must submit their applications before the deadline, as late submissions will only be considered if space is still available.

The online application process begins on June 1, 2025, with closing dates varying by program. Admission for first-year undergraduate students is highly competitive, with limited spots available. Selection is based on academic performance, available spaces, and the timing of application submissions—applying early is strongly advised.

Applications are now open for certificates, diplomas, degrees, honors, master’s, and PhD programs at the University Of Pretoria. Prospective students are encouraged to apply as soon as possible to secure their place in their preferred course.

Steps to Apply to University Of Pretoria (UP) 2026

Follow the steps below to complete the University Of Pretoria 2026 applications before the deadline:

  • Visit www.up.ac.za
  • Click on “Apply Online.”
  • From the drop-down menu, select “Start a New Application.”
  • Accept the privacy notice by clicking OK.
  • Ensure that all special characters are correctly entered.
  • Provide your personal details in the required fields.
  • Carefully enter the characters shown in the security code field.
  • Click on the “Go” tab to proceed.
  • Read the application confirmation page and disclaimer carefully—keep this page for reference.
  • Complete the required fields in the drop-down sections.
  • Click OK to confirm your details.
  • Verify and finalize your application, then click “Continue.”
  • You will receive a student ID and temporary password via email—ensure you use an active email address.
  • Use your ID number and password to log in by following the link provided in the email.
  • If desired, create a new password for future access.
  • Click “Save and Next” to continue.
  • Review and edit your application summary page before proceeding.
  • Begin your online application and ensure all required fields are completed.
  • Upload the necessary documents in the correct format.
  • Pay the non-refundable application fee into the university’s official account.

UP Application Deadlines for the 2026 Academic Year

Prospective students planning to enroll at the University Of Pretoria should be aware of the following application deadlines. Late applications will only be considered if space is still available, so it is strongly recommended to apply early.

  • Saturday, 31 May 2025: Veterinary Science programmes
  • Monday, 30 June 2025: All other programmes

Make sure to submit your application before the deadline to secure your place.

Minimum Admission Requirements for University of Pretoria (UP) Qualifications

Higher Certificate

Applicants seeking admission into a Higher Certificate program at the University of Pretoria must meet the following minimum requirements:

  • Possession of an NCV Level 4 qualification issued by the Council for General and Further Education and Training.

Diploma

To qualify for a Diploma program at UP, applicants must meet these requirements:

  • An NCV Level 4 qualification issued by the Council for General and Further Education and Training.
  • A minimum of 40% in three (3) Fundamental subjects, including the institution’s language of instruction.
  • At least 50% in three (3) compulsory Vocational subjects.
  • Compliance with the minimum admission criteria of the university.

Bachelor’s Degree

For admission into a Bachelor’s Degree program at UP, applicants must meet the following criteria:

  • An NCV Level 4 qualification issued by the Council for General and Further Education and Training.
  • A minimum of 50% in three (3) Fundamental subjects, including the institution’s language of instruction.
  • At least 60% in four (4) compulsory Vocational subjects.
  • Fulfillment of the university’s minimum admission requirements.

To study at the University Of Pretoria, the minimum Admission Point Score (APS) needed is 26 points or higher, depending on the program (Calculate your APS).
